Easy Milk Bread Loaf

Easy Milk Bread Loaf

This Easy Milk Bread Loaf is a delightful homemade bread that's perfect for sandwiches or toast.

Equipment

  • stand mixer
  • 10 x 5 loaf pan
  • Rolling Pin

Ingredients
  

Flour Mixture

  • 500 g bread flour approximately 3¾ cups
  • 40 g sugar approximately 3 tablespoons
  • 1.5 tsps instant yeast
  • 225 g cold water a little bit less than 1 cup
  • 115 g cold milk approximately ½ cup
  • 9 g sea salt approximately 1½ tsps
  • 25 g unsalted butter approximately 1¾ tablespoons

Other ingredients

  • butter for coating the pan and brushing the bread
  • flour for coating the pan

Instructions
 

Making Bread Dough

  • Mix bread flour, sugar, yeast, water and milk in a stand mixer, kneading on low speed until the dough is formed.
  • Cover the mixing bowl and let it rest for 30 minutes. Meanwhile, bring the butter out from the fridge, cut it into 4 pieces and leave it on the counter to soften a little.
  • Add salt and continue to knead the dough for 1 minute.
  • Add butter cubes and knead until the dough passes the windowpane test.
  • Form the dough into a ball and put it in a lightly greased bowl. Cover and let it rise for 1 hour until it almost doubles in size.

Shaping

  • Transfer the dough onto a working surface and cut it into 3 even pieces. Form each piece into a ball and let them rest for 15 minutes.
  • Roll the dough out with a rolling pin to an oval shape and then roll it up to a log. Repeat for the other two pieces, then let them rest for another 15 minutes.
  • For each log, rotate the dough 90 degrees before rolling them out again into long rectangles and rolling each rectangle back up.
  • Grease a 10 x 5 loaf pan and coat with flour. Place the rolled up dough into the pan, cover and let it rise until it fills 80-90% of the pan.

Baking

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F in the last 20 minutes of proofing.
  • Bake for 30-35 minutes, loosely covering with foil after 15 minutes.
  • Remove bread from the oven and drop the pan on the counter to prevent it from shrinking, then transfer the bread to a cooling rack and brush with melted butter.

Notes

Measure your ingredients precisely, especially for flour and liquids. Use cold liquids to prevent the dough from warming up during kneading.
